This sweet girl is Shelby. She was an owner surrender as the family said they no longer had time for her so a nice family has taken her in to foster her until we can find her a forever home. I do not know why anyone would not have time for this sweet girl. She is up to date on shots, spayed, heartworm negative and on preventative, good with cats-kids-other dogs and all adults, crated trained, house trained and weighs about 25 pounds. She is 4 to 5 years old and has a cute small underbite. The only thing she doesn't like is bad storms- but who does?? More about ShelbyGood with Dogs, Good with Cats, Good with Kids, Good with Adults, Quiet, Does Good in the Car, Leashtrained, Cratetrained, Likes to play with toys, Obedient, Playful, Affectionate, Eager To Please, Intelligent, Even-tempered, Gentle Our typical adoption fee for puppies younger than 6 months old is $400, and for older puppies and adults, the usual fee is $350. This includes microchip, spay/neuter, up to date on age appropriate vaccinations, dewormings, flea/tick treatment, and heartworm test (if over 6 months old) as well as heartworm treatment if they test positive. There is a transport fee of $150 per dog, depending on the transporter. We use Pack Leaders Rescue Dog Transport most often, but also use Hearts Transport as well on occasion.
